Hilarious! Kinda reinforces the idea that LLMs are like junior engineers with infinite energy.

But just telling an AI it's a principal engineer does not make it a principal engineer. Firstly, that is such a broad, vaguely defined term, and secondly, typically that level of engineering involves dealing with organizational and industry issues rather than just technical ones.

And so absent a clear definition, it will settle on the lowest common denominator of code quality, which would be test coverage -- likely because that is the most common topic in its training data -- and extrapolate from that.

The other thing is, of course, the RL'd sycophancy which compels it to do something, anything, to obey the prompt. I wonder what would happen if tweaked the prompt just a little bit to say something like "Use your best judgement and feel free to change nothing."
